2011 White House Easter Egg Roll

Friday, March 11, 2011

Many constituents have inquired about how to get tickets for the White House Easter Egg roll that takes place on April 25.  If you are interested in participating, you can apply for tickets at www.recreation.gov.  For more details about these free tickets, please visit www.whitehouse.gov/eastereggroll.  The deadline to apply for free tickets is Sunday, March 13 at 11:59 p.m.

Please note that while these tickets are free, you are responsible for your  own travel, lodging, and associated costs.

The White House also has commemorative wooden Easter eggs for sale.  For more information, please visit http://easter.nationalparks.org.
